Key Factors To Consider When Selecting A Shipping Solution For Your E-commerce Business

When it comes to running an e-commerce business, selecting the right shipping solution is crucial for the success of your operations. But with countless options available, how do you decide which one is the best fit for your needs? In this article, we will explore key factors to consider when selecting a shipping solution for your e-commerce business. From cost and flexibility to reliability and customer service, we will delve into the essential elements you should keep in mind to ensure smooth and efficient shipping logistics. So, let’s navigate through the various considerations together, so you can make an informed decision that will benefit your online business.

Understanding the Importance of a Good Shipping Solution

The role of shipping in e-commerce

When it comes to running an e-commerce business, shipping plays a crucial role in ensuring the success and satisfaction of your customers. Shipping is the final step in the online purchasing process, and it is responsible for physically delivering the products to your customers’ doorsteps. A good shipping solution can improve the overall customer experience, resulting in higher customer satisfaction and repeat purchases.

Impacts of shipping on customer satisfaction

The speed, reliability, and cost of shipping directly impact customer satisfaction. Customers today expect fast and reliable shipping, and any delays or issues with the shipping process can lead to disappointment and frustration. On the other hand, when customers receive their orders quickly and in perfect condition, it creates a positive impression and reinforces their trust in your brand. A good shipping solution can ensure timely deliveries, reduce shipping errors, and provide accurate package tracking, all of which contribute to a high level of customer satisfaction.

How shipping affects return rates

Return rates are another important factor to consider when evaluating the effectiveness of your shipping solution. Customers are more likely to return a product if they encounter difficulties with the return process or if the product does not meet their expectations. A smooth and hassle-free return process can significantly reduce return rates and improve customer loyalty. By offering pre-paid return labels, clear return instructions, and efficient return logistics, you can provide a positive experience for customers who need to return a product.

Analysis of Your Shipping Needs

Measure your business volume

Before choosing a shipping solution, it is essential to assess your business volume. Evaluate the number of daily or weekly orders and the size and weight of your products. By understanding your business volume, you can determine which shipping providers can handle your capacity and meet your delivery deadlines consistently.

Identify key markets

Understanding your target market and identifying your key markets is crucial for selecting the right shipping solution. If you are selling internationally, you need a shipping solution that can handle cross-border shipping efficiently, including dealing with customs regulations and documentation. Additionally, if you have specific target markets within your country, you may need to prioritize shipping providers that have a strong presence in those regions.

Determine common order sizes

Analyzing your typical order sizes will help you assess whether certain shipping methods or providers are more suited to your business needs. If you primarily sell large and heavy items, you may need a shipping solution that specializes in handling oversized packages. Conversely, if your products are small and lightweight, you may have more flexibility in choosing a shipping provider that offers cost-effective options for smaller packages.

Comparing Different Shipping Solutions

Common shipping methods

There are several shipping methods available to e-commerce businesses, each with its own advantages and considerations. Some common shipping methods include standard ground shipping, expedited shipping, express shipping, and same-day delivery. Understanding the different shipping methods and their associated costs and delivery times can help you select the most appropriate option for your customers’ needs.

Understanding carrier offerings

Different carriers offer various services and options, such as package tracking, insurance, and delivery guarantees. Researching and comparing carrier offerings can provide insights into what each carrier prioritizes and whether those services align with your business requirements. For example, if you value real-time package tracking, selecting a carrier that offers comprehensive tracking capabilities will be advantageous.

Price comparisons

Price is an important factor to consider when selecting a shipping solution. While you want to offer competitive shipping rates to your customers, you also need to ensure that your shipping costs remain manageable for your business. Comparing the pricing structures of different shipping solutions will allow you to find a balance between affordability and service quality.

Exploring Automation Possibilities

Benefits of shipping automation

Shipping automation can significantly improve the efficiency and accuracy of your shipping processes while saving you time and resources. By automating tasks such as label printing, order fulfillment, and package tracking, you can streamline your operations, reduce human error, and enhance overall productivity. Automation also enables you to scale your shipping processes as your business grows.

Integrating automation with your platform

To fully leverage shipping automation, it is crucial to integrate it with your e-commerce platform. Many e-commerce platforms offer shipping integration options, allowing you to connect directly with shipping carriers and automate various shipping tasks. Seamless integration can streamline your order fulfillment workflow and eliminate the need for manual data entry, reducing the risk of errors and accelerating shipping times.

Potential challenges with shipping automation

While shipping automation offers numerous benefits, it is important to be aware of the potential challenges that may arise. Implementing automation requires careful planning and testing to ensure that all systems are properly integrated and functioning correctly. Additionally, there may be a learning curve for your employees as they adapt to new processes and technology. It is essential to provide adequate training and support to ensure a smooth transition to a fully automated shipping solution.

Understanding Shipping Rates

Weight-based pricing

Weight-based pricing is a common method used by shipping carriers to calculate the cost of shipping a package. The heavier the package, the higher the shipping cost will be. This pricing structure can be advantageous for e-commerce businesses that primarily sell lightweight products as it allows for cost-effective shipping rates. However, it is important to consider the potential impact of weight-based pricing on the overall profitability of your business, especially if you sell heavy or bulky items.

Flat-rate shipping

Flat-rate shipping offers a fixed shipping cost regardless of the weight or size of the package. This pricing model can be beneficial for businesses that ship items of varying weights and sizes, as it simplifies the calculation of shipping costs. Flat-rate shipping is also advantageous for customers, as they know the exact shipping cost upfront, which can contribute to a positive purchasing experience. However, it is important to assess whether flat-rate shipping is financially viable for your business, considering factors such as average package weight and shipping distance.

Free shipping thresholds

Offering free shipping for orders that meet a certain purchase threshold can be an effective strategy to encourage customers to spend more. By setting a minimum order amount, you can offset the shipping costs and provide an added incentive for customers to add more items to their carts. However, it is important to carefully analyze your profit margins and evaluate the impact of free shipping on your bottom line. It is also crucial to ensure that your shipping solution can accommodate the additional volume of orders that may result from implementing a free shipping threshold.

Investigating Carrier Reliability

Carrier delivery speed

The speed at which carriers deliver packages can significantly impact customer satisfaction. Customers expect their orders to arrive on time, and any delays can lead to frustration and a negative perception of your brand. It is important to research and compare the delivery speed of different carriers, taking into account their track record for delivering packages promptly and reliably. Choosing a carrier with a reputation for fast and efficient deliveries can help ensure that your customers receive their orders in a timely manner.

Carrier tracking capabilities

Clear and accurate package tracking is an essential component of a good shipping solution. Customers want to be able to track their shipments and know exactly when to expect their packages. Carrier tracking capabilities vary, and it is important to select a carrier that offers comprehensive tracking services. This will enable you to provide your customers with real-time tracking updates, reducing anxiety and improving their overall shopping experience.

Carrier customer service

Customer service is another crucial aspect to consider when evaluating carrier reliability. In the event of shipping issues or customer inquiries, prompt and helpful customer service can make a significant difference. Researching the reputation of carriers for their customer service can give you insights into their responsiveness and willingness to resolve issues quickly. Choosing a carrier with excellent customer service can help ensure that any shipping-related concerns are addressed efficiently, minimizing customer frustration and dissatisfaction.

Pondering Packaging Options

Importance of packaging

Packaging plays a vital role in protecting products during the shipping process and creating a positive unboxing experience for customers. Durable and secure packaging can prevent damage and ensure that the product arrives in pristine condition. Additionally, thoughtful packaging can enhance the overall customer experience and leave a lasting impression. It is important to invest in suitable packaging materials and design packaging that reflects your brand identity and values.

Reducing packaging costs

While packaging is important, it is also crucial to find ways to reduce packaging costs without compromising product protection. Working with packaging experts can help you identify cost-effective packaging solutions that meet your specific needs. Optimizing packaging size and weight can also help reduce shipping costs and minimize waste. By striking a balance between cost efficiency and adequate protection, you can achieve both financial savings and customer satisfaction.

Environmental impacts of packaging

Sustainability is an increasingly important consideration for businesses in all industries, including e-commerce. Packaging materials contribute to waste and environmental pollution, and customers are becoming more conscious of the environmental impact of their purchases. Consider using eco-friendly packaging options, such as recyclable or biodegradable materials, to align with customer values and reduce your carbon footprint. Communicating your commitment to sustainability through your packaging can also resonate with environmentally conscious customers and contribute to a positive brand image.

Planning for International Shipping

Catering to international customers

Expanding your business globally requires careful considerations for international shipping. International customers have unique needs and expectations, and it is important to cater to them effectively. Researching the preferences and expectations of customers in different countries can help you tailor your shipping solutions and ensure a smooth international shopping experience. Providing accurate and transparent information about international shipping costs, delivery times, and customs procedures can help build trust with international customers.

Understanding international shipping costs

International shipping costs can vary significantly depending on the destination, package weight, and shipping method. It is important to thoroughly assess and compare international shipping costs offered by different providers to find the most cost-effective solution for your business. It is also essential to consider any additional fees, such as customs duties or taxes, that may be incurred during the international shipping process. By understanding and accounting for these costs, you can accurately calculate your pricing and ensure profitability in international markets.

Regulations for cross-border shipping

Cross-border shipping involves compliance with various regulations and customs procedures. Familiarizing yourself with the regulations and requirements of the countries you plan to ship to is crucial to avoid any legal issues or delays in customs clearance. This includes understanding prohibited or restricted items and ensuring that you have the necessary documentation and labels for international shipments. Partnering with a shipping solution provider that specializes in international shipping can be beneficial, as they can guide you through the compliance process and help you navigate any challenges that may arise.

Considering Return Policies

Impacts of return policy on customer satisfaction

A clear and customer-friendly return policy has a significant impact on customer satisfaction and loyalty. Customers need to have confidence that they can easily return or exchange a product if it does not meet their expectations. A hassle-free return policy can give customers peace of mind and increase their trust in your brand. Clearly communicate your return policy on your website, and make sure it is easily accessible and understandable for your customers.

Costs associated with returns

Returns can incur costs for your business, including shipping fees, restocking fees, and product devaluation. It is important to factor in these costs when assessing the financial viability of your return policy. Additionally, consider implementing measures to minimize return rates, such as providing detailed product descriptions and images, offering sizing charts, and providing exceptional customer support. Proactively addressing any potential issues or concerns can help reduce the frequency of returns and mitigate associated costs.

Managing return logistics

Efficiently managing return logistics is essential for a smooth and customer-friendly return process. Streamline your return process by providing pre-paid return labels, clear instructions, and easy-to-follow return procedures. Consider implementing technology solutions that facilitate return tracking and automate return processing to minimize manual effort and ensure accurate inventory management. A well-managed return process can turn a potentially negative experience into an opportunity to exceed customer expectations, enhance brand loyalty, and encourage repeat purchases.

Looking at Scalability of Shipping Solutions

Future-proofing your shipping

When selecting a shipping solution, it is important to consider the scalability of the solution to accommodate future growth. As your business expands, the volume of orders and shipping requirements will likely increase. Ensure that your chosen shipping solution can scale accordingly, both in terms of its technological capabilities and its ability to handle larger order volumes. Scalable shipping solutions can help you maintain operational efficiency and provide consistent service levels as your business grows.

Growing with your shipping provider

Establishing a long-term partnership with your shipping provider can be beneficial as your business evolves. A shipping provider that understands your business needs and actively supports your growth can provide valuable guidance and customized solutions. Regular communication and collaboration with your shipping provider can help ensure that your shipping processes remain optimized and aligned with your business goals. Prioritize shipping providers that demonstrate a strong commitment to customer success and have a track record of helping businesses grow.

When to consider changing shipping providers

While maintaining a long-term partnership with your shipping provider is ideal, there may be situations where changing providers becomes necessary. If your business outgrows your current shipping solution, and it no longer meets your capacity or service level requirements, it may be time to explore alternative options. Additionally, if your shipping provider consistently fails to meet delivery expectations or provides subpar customer service, it may be in your best interest to consider switching to a more reliable and customer-focused provider. Regularly evaluate your shipping solution to ensure that it continues to meet your evolving needs and supports your business growth.
